Question

Is PPh3a strong ligand?


Open in App
Solution

Explanation:

  1. Ligand: The substance or species which donates its pair of electrons to the central metal ion is called a ligand.
  2. The ligands are categorized mainly into two types one is a strong field ligand and the other is a weak field ligand.
  3. Which can provide the pairing of electrons during the bond formation is called a strong field ligand. Example: CN-,CO
  4. A ligand that is unable to pair the electron is called a weak field ligand. Example: F-,H2O
  5. PPh3 is a strong field ligand. It is a π acceptor ligand.

Hence, PPh3 is a strong field ligand.
